Dark Souls The Willow King Comics Releasing Next Year

‘I’m overjoyed to be returning to the dark, grim, Hollow-ridden world of Dark Souls for this brand-new comic series,’ says artist Maan House.

A new Dark Souls comic is launching early next year. While no new Dark Souls games are in the works, fans can enjoy Dark Souls: The Willow King coming January 2024 from Titan Comics. George Mann writes the upcoming four-issue series with Maan House serving as artist.

“I’m overjoyed to be returning to the dark, grim, Hollow-ridden world of Dark Souls for this brand-new comic series,” says Mann. “Like an Unkindled, we’re rising from the ashes to bring you something entirely new and exciting. We’ll journey with Herad the Unlived as he and his companions seek out a reluctant Lord of Cinder, The Willow King, to try to bend him to his task. Expect new monsters! Giants! Unseen horrors! Dungeon delves and ruined cities! Will the flame ever be linked? You’ll have to read to find out… unless the Hollows get to you first…”

Issue 1 boasts multiple covers

The first issue of the upcoming series will come with a variety of cover variants. Artists behind the cover variants include Stephanie Hans, Maan House, Alan Quah, Nick Marinkovich, and Diego Yapur. Further, Foil editions of the Alan Quah covers will also be available. The official description of the upcoming issue, which releases on January 31st of next year, is as follows:

“The mighty king Ustrad Of Uthrel linked the flame, after his servant Herad failed and was consumed by the fire, reduced to ashes.

Now, the time has come to link the fire again, but Ustrad now refuses to do his duty to his kingdom. Herad , resurrected as unkindled, returns to unite three mighty warriors to venture into the Willow King’s domain and do what needs to be done…”

Dark Souls is far from the first video game to live on through comics. Horror title Dead By Daylight received a comic book adaptation earlier this year. Similarly, the first issue of Life is Strange: True Color’s comic adaptation Life Is Strange: Forget-Me-Not releases in December.
